Description

White Trash Circus will be taking an extended break and won’t be playing any time in the foreseeable future. Please lodge all your complaints to my guitarist—and my ex best friend—who I found inside the girlfriend I’ve had since high school. I will pull the freaking knife from my back and continue—without either of them—when the time is right. With enough hate and anger coursing through my veins to keep me in therapy for life, I’m going to save my cash and let the music heal me. Prepare all your bleeding hearts to be tormented with the most righteous, heavy and cataclysmic tunes to ever come out of me. So there’s that to look forward to. Thank you for all the support over the years, the gigs, the love and most of all memories. Don’t trust anyone and stay metal—Vaughan.

PS. Connor, you left your guitar and rig at my house so I took the liberty of relocating it to my front lawn. I might have dropped it on the way out the door. In your own words, brother, “Sometimes stuff just happens.”

PPS. Our drummer spontaneously combusted and is no longer with us.

WhiteTrashMegaFan- Whoa! Is this real?

VaughanLover4Eva - I love you Vaughan, you were too good for her anyway. I want to have your babies.

HeavyBrad69– So rock and roll!! Can’t wait for the new stuff, it’s going to be metal AF!

Nico – Ummm, Vaughan, what about me?

LicksNStick - LOL awks

White Trash Circus – No one cares about the bass player, Nico.

    Nobody writes a rockstar romance like this author! I found myself chuckling from page one and entertained by the humor interspersed throughout this sweet, fun, and sexy book. Vaughan’s hilarious rant on social media about being burned by his girlfriend and his bandmate/best friend sets off a series of events that completely changes his life. Vaughan is impulsive and stubborn and this lands him in hot water. I loved his sarcasm and his humorous thought processes. He is completely naive in the rock world, but Gillian is there to help him navigate the cutthroat, manipulative music industry. Gillian, the daughter of a distant man who owns a massive record label, sets out to prove herself in a man’s world. She is serious and dedicated and comes across as a no nonsense businesswoman. I love her sassiness and how she sees the potential in the insanely good looking Vaughan who possesses a powerful, amazing singing voice. The two of them have an instant attraction that cannot be denied and I love how Vaughan is able to see the fire that lays beneath her cool exterior. The two of them make a great couple with their passion and chemistry as well as bringing out the best in each other. I really enjoyed this hilarious romantic rockstar romance. The main characters were engaging and well-developed as well as having some great secondary characters. It was interesting seeing the behind the scenes of a band making it in the competitive music industry. I received an early complimentary copy of this book.
